Casement windows

Casement windows are a very popular choice in the UK. They provide a broad range of benefits and come in various designs and colors.

Casement windows have the advantage of providing excellent ventilation and airflow. These windows are generally made from uPVC, which is highly durable and resists discoloration, water and long-term exposure to sunlight.

Unlike other window products UPVC casement windows can be bought at a reasonable cost. They can be tailored to meet the specific needs of a home. They are among the most versatile windows on the market, with over 80 configuration options.

There are plenty of design features that can be added to a casement window to make it distinctive. Coloured foil finishes, obscure glass, and patterned glass may all be used. A foil finish that is colored gives you an authentic timber look , but does not peel like paint.

uPVC casement windows come with an Aenergy rating. Triple-glazed glass can also be installed to help save energy. They also come with restriction of movement that could be helpful for people with limited mobility or children.

Many uPVC casement windows come in traditional white or darker hues. They are available in a range of two to eight panels, and are also available in a variety of colors.

Depending on the type of uPVC you select it is possible to select a casement that opens either in the middle or on the side. Casement windows feature an integrated locking mechanism for maximum security. This makes them extremely difficult to break into.

UPVC casement windows can be installed in a variety places such as conservatories and garden rooms. They are a fantastic option due to their attractive designs and high energy efficiency.

Sill endcaps

Sill end caps prevent water from getting into the bottom corners of uPVC windows. They have a curved front edge that gives the window a neat modern look.

End caps are available in a variety of styles, colors, and sizes. Pick the most appropriate one for your installation.

Double end caps allow the sills to be sealed to the sides with the double caps. This option requires an order separately.
